    What is Dr. John Baker's specialty?

    Dr. Baker is a Pediatric Gastroenterologist near Plano, TX. A pediatrician specializing in diagnosing and treating digestive system diseases in infants, children, and adolescents. This expert manages conditions like abdominal pain, ulcers, diarrhea, cancer, and jaundice and is skilled in performing complex diagnostic and therapeutic procedures using endoscopic techniques to visualize internal organs.     Is this Dr. John Baker affiliated with a ranked Castle Connolly Top Hospital?

    Yes, Dr. Baker is affiliated with Texas Health Presbyterian Hospital Plano which is a Castle Connolly Top Hospital. Castle Connolly Top Hospitals are healthcare institutions recognized for their excellence in specific medical procedures and overall patient care. They are identified through a rigorous peer nomination process, evaluating factors like patient outcomes, quality of care, and expertise. The list recognizes hospitals that excel in 20 or more specific medical procedures, representing the top 25% nationwide. Castle Connolly Top Hospitals
